本文将为您介绍 AWS 高级优化技巧,帮助您更好地利用 AWS 服务。

1. 自动扩展

AWS Auto Scaling 可以自动调整您的应用程序所需的服务器数量,以应对流量变化。您可以根据需求设置扩展规则,确保应用程序的稳定性和性能。

2. 弹性负载均衡

AWS Elastic Load Balancing 可以分发流量到多个实例,提高应用程序的可用性和响应速度。您可以根据需要选择不同的负载均衡类型,如应用程序负载均衡器和网络负载均衡器。

3. 缓存

使用 AWS ElastiCache 可以提高您的应用程序的性能,通过缓存常用数据,减少对后端存储的访问次数。

4. 云数据库

AWS 提供多种云数据库服务,如 Amazon RDS、Amazon DynamoDB 等,您可以根据应用程序的需求选择合适的数据库服务。

5. 监控和日志

使用 AWS CloudWatch 可以监控您的应用程序和基础设施的性能,并记录相关的日志信息。

AWS CloudWatch